The size of Albion is approximately 1.4 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 22.1% of total area. The population of Albion in 2016 was 2296 people. By 2021 the population was 3446 showing a population growth of 50.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Albion is 20-29 years. Households in Albion are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Albion work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 34.20% of the homes in Albion were owner-occupied compared with 37.50% in 2016.
